Abstract
Methods of amplifying and determining a target nucleotide sequence are provided. The method of amplifying the target nucleotide sequence includes the following steps. A first adaptor and a second adaptor are linked to two ends of a double-stranded nucleic acid molecule with a target nucleotide sequence respectively to form a nucleic acid template, in which the first adaptor includes a Y-form adaptor or a hairpin adaptor and the second adaptor is a hairpin adaptor. Then, a PCR amplification cycle is performed on the nucleic acid template to obtain a PCR amplicon of the target nucleotide sequence.
